| Lite-On LTR-48246s "Invalid Write State" "Could not perform EndTrack" Errors Hi im kinda n00bish when it comes to burners so please forgive any mistakes I make. My LTR-48246s seems to fail 50% of the time ever since i upgraded to a Soltek SL-75FRN2 R (nforce2) mobo and installed Windows service pack 1. Im using Nero 5.5.9.2 Bundled software and 50% of the time i get the error "Invalid Write State" then "Could not perform EndTrack". Before this on my MSI K7TPRO2-A (VIA KT133) motherboard it used to work completely fine. I use Ricoh 1-32x Type 80 700mb CDR's to burn and burn at 48x. Unfortunatly i cant provide you with a log because in my rage i forgot to save it, and when i tried burning the cd again it work fine with no probs. Ill try and get a log posted the next time it fails. Also can someone explain firmware to me? so far i get the impression its the BIOS for your CDRW Thanx System Specs: Soltek SL-75FRN2 R 2400XP+ 266 Kingston 512 2700 Geforce 3 Ti 200 64mb IBM Deskstar 40GB IC35L040AVER07-0 Lite-On LTN 485 Lite-On LTR 48246s Winmodem 56k Leadman POWMAX 400w PSU |

| if u're using the nforce2 ide drivers, uninstall them and use microsoft's.

| Also try writing at lower speeds and try other media types as this error is often caused by bad media.....
